The Itinerary: Carefully Curated Route for Maximum Impact

Rome Golf Cart - The Itinerary: Carefully Curated Route for Maximum Impact

The itinerary begins at the Colosseum with sightseeing, followed by a 10-minute ride to the Circus Maximus. Afterward, the group visits the Mouth of Truth and proceeds to Piazza Venezia, where a 20-minute guided tour uncovers the area’s history and significance.

The tour then moves to Largo di Torre Argentina for a brief 10-minute visit, then to Piazza Navona for a lively 20-minute stop. The Pantheon and the Trevi Fountain are both short, focused visits of about 10 minutes each, allowing for photos, quick explorations, and appreciation of their beauty.

Finally, the tour concludes at Piazza Trilussa, a lively square where participants can relax or explore further on their own. The total route balances sightseeing, cruising, and breaks, all within a 2.5-hour window.

Practical Details: What to Bring and How to Prepare

Rome Golf Cart - Practical Details: What to Bring and How to Prepare

Given the outdoor nature of this tour, comfortable shoes are recommended for walking around each site. Protect your eyes with sunglasses and stay hydrated with water, especially on warmer days. Since the tour runs rain or shine, packing a light rain jacket or umbrella can be wise.

Participants must bring a valid photo ID for the tour check-in. The tour is conducted in English, and booking must be made at least 3 hours in advance. The group size is limited to 7 people, ensuring a relaxed and attentive experience.
